There is a general wisdom: if you invoke "the ends justify the means" you have crossed the border to the Dark Side.
I'm not going to explain my full understanding of this piece of wisdom, it would be a wall of text, I want just mention that this behavior is addictive: it is much easier to start justifying your means than to stop it. And over time those justifications become more and more flexible.
I'm ready to agree that there are situations in which ends justify the means, but if you are not aware of downsides in your particular case, and if it doesn't seem controversial to you, you are most likely mistaken and the ends do not justify the means.
